About

Holes 18
Type Resort
Style Links
Par 71
Length 6300 yards
Slope 124
Rating 69.7

The Links at Arizona Biltmore Golf Club is the "younger" of two golf courses on the Biltmore property, and offers intelligence and innovation, with little room for impatience, on a much-feted design that fast gained reverence from both local and visiting golfers. The golf course features fairways that wind amidst lush pine trees and some of Phoenix's showier houses, greens so bunkered that precision is the minimum to shoot for, and contoured greens that roll as they come. Put the ball where it belongs, and it'll show up on the scorecard; put the ball where it doesn't, and that will show up, too.

Course Details

Year Built 1979
Fairways Bermuda Grass
Greens Bermuda Grass
Golf Season Year round
Architect Bill Johnston (1979) Forrest Richardson Jack Snyder (1992)

Day before overseed but weren’t warned

We paid approx $100 each to play this course which was essentially a dry, dusty dead track. The greens were fine but the tee boxes and fairways were dead. We weren’t warned that it was the last day before overseeing, and as Canadians visiting, we had no idea how dead a course could be. We should have been told that the course had not yet been over seeded and was in rough shape so we could decide if we wanted to fork over that much money.

Poor course conditions

The Biltmore seems much more focused on the refurb of the Adobe course and the new buildings than keeping the course they have open in good shape. Greens were rough, fairways were thin and patchy. Some of the tee boxes were hard as a rock. I’ve played the Adobe course before and felt like the conditions were pretty good, this was a different story.
